Welcome home to your spacious and inviting end unit row house! This 3-bedroom 2 bath gem with hard wood floors throughout that boasts a cozy ambiance with not one, but two fireplaces currently not used, . Spread across three levels, there's ample space for every need. Old world charm and craftsmanship. Pocket doors, solid woodwork and the potential to be so much more. The basement offers entrance and exit, flexibility as a recreation area or additional living space. Step outside to your fenced yard, front, side,back, providing space for outdoor activities or gardening. The lot is large making the possibilities of additions endless. Street parking ensures convenience for you and your guests. Located on capitol hill and close to the Historic RFK Stadium, commuting is a breeze, while nearby amenities offer shopping, dining, and entertainment options. 1025 D St NE, Washington, DC 20002 is a 3 bedroom, 2 bathroom, 2,103 sqft townhouse built in 1902. 1025 D St NE is located in Capitol Hill, Washington. This property is not currently available for sale. 1025 D St NE was last sold on Nov 20, 2024 for $904,000 (9% lower than the asking price of $994,000).
